mm, list_lru: refactor the locking code

Cocci is confused by the try lock then release RCU and return logic here.
So separate the try lock part out into a standalone helper.  The code is
easier to follow too.

No feature change, fixes:

cocci warnings: (new ones prefixed by >>)
>> mm/list_lru.c:82:3-9: preceding lock on line 77
>> mm/list_lru.c:82:3-9: preceding lock on line 77
   mm/list_lru.c:82:3-9: preceding lock on line 75
   mm/list_lru.c:82:3-9: preceding lock on line 75
